新闻资讯

质量为本、客户为根、勇于拼搏、务实创新

< 返回新闻资讯列表

Sqlite和MySQL有哪几种关键差异

发布时间:2024-06-15 22:55:58

Sqlite和MySQL有哪几种关键差异

  1. 数据库类型:SQLite是一种轻量级的嵌入式数据库,适用于单用户或小范围利用程序,通常存储在单个文件中。而MySQL是一种客户端/服务器数据库管理系统,适用于多用户或大范围利用程序,通常以服务器的情势运行。

  2. 功能支持:MySQL具有更多的功能和扩大性,支持更多的数据类型、存储引擎和高级功能,如存储进程、触发器、视图等。而SQLite功能较为简单,不支持存储进程、触发器等高级功能。

  3. 性能表现:由于SQLite是嵌入式数据库,数据存储在单个文件中,因此在读取和写入数据方面性能较好。但当数据量较大时,MySQL的客户端/服务器模式可以更好地处理大范围数据,并提供更好的性能。

  4. 并发性能:MySQL支持更好的并发处理能力,能够同时处理多个连接和并发要求。而SQLite在处理大量并发连接时性能可能会遭到影响。

总的来讲,SQLite适用于简单的小范围利用程序,具有简单的部署和管理,而MySQL适用于大范围利用程序,具有更多的功能和扩大性。选择哪一种数据库取决于利用程序的需求和范围。

tiktok粉丝购买:https://www.smmfensi.com/